Posting Language
Title
Authorize contracts for compost processing services for Austin Resource Recovery with Employee Owned Nursery Enterprises Ltd. dba Organics By Gosh, and Texas Disposal Systems Landfill, Inc. dba Texas Disposal Systems Inc., for an initial term of three years with up to two 1-year extension options in an amount not to exceed $10,000,000 divided among the contractors. Funding: $333,333 is available in the Operating Budget of Austin Resource Recovery. Funding for the remaining contract term is contingent upon available funding in future budgets.

Body
Lead Department
Financial Services Department.

Client Department(s)
Austin Resource Recovery.

Fiscal Note
Funding in the amount of $333,333 is available in the Fiscal Year 2024-2025 Operating Budget of Austin Resource Recovery.

Funding for the remaining contract term is contingent upon available funding in future budgets.

Purchasing Language:
The Financial Services Department issued an Invitation for Bids solicitation (IFB) 1500 RGW1023REBID for these services. The solicitation was issued on May 19, 2025, and closed on June 12, 2025. Of the two offers received, the recommended contractors submitted the lowest responsive offers. A complete solicitation package, including a tabulation of the bids received, is available for viewing on the City's website. This information can currently be found at https://financeonline.austintexas.gov/afo/account_services/solicitation/solicitation_details.cfm?sid=142753.

MBE/WBE:
This contract will be awarded in accordance with City Code Chapter 2-9B (Minority-Owned and Women-Owned Business Enterprise Procurement Program). For the services required for this solicitation, there were no subcontracting opportunities; therefore, no subcontracting goals were established. However, one of the recommended contractors identified subcontracting opportunities.
